  1. Which type of damages in a structured settlement are generally NOT excluded from the claimant's taxable income? โ†’ Punitive damages
  2. Which of the following is a primary consideration when designing a payment schedule for a catastrophically injured claimant? โ†’ Ensuring sufficient funds for lifetime medical care, rehabilitation, and living expenses
  3. The IRC Section 130 deduction available to the assignment company is equal to: โ†’ The amount paid to purchase the annuity funding the assigned obligation
  4. Which professional organization in the US primarily represents structured settlement industry professionals? โ†’ National Structured Settlements Trade Association (NSSTA)
  5. What is a 'life-contingent' structured settlement payment? โ†’ A payment that is made only if the claimant is still alive
  6. Which of the following payment features can be included in a structured settlement annuity? โ†’ Cost-of-living adjustments (COLA) tied to CPI
  7. Which of the following is NOT a typical type of structured settlement payment schedule? โ†’ Declining government bond yields
  8. Who owns the annuity contract in a typical structured settlement qualified assignment? โ†’ The qualified assignee
  9. What is the typical waiting period required between the disclosure statement and the signing of a transfer agreement under SSPAs? โ†’ At least 3 days but commonly 3โ€“10 business days depending on the state
  10. Under IRC ยง5891, what federal excise tax is imposed on factoring companies that purchase structured settlement payment rights without court approval? โ†’ 40%
  11. What is a structured settlement? โ†’ A series of periodic payments made to a claimant over time as part of a legal settlement
  12. Which federal agency reviews Workers' Compensation Medicare Set-Aside proposals? โ†’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S)
  13. Which IRC section exempts personal physical injury structured settlement payments from federal income tax? โ†’ IRC ยง104(a)(2)
  14. Under which IRC section are workers' compensation periodic payments excluded from federal income tax? โ†’ IRC ยง104(a)(1)
  15. Which Internal Revenue Code section excludes structured settlement periodic payments for physical personal injury from gross income? โ†’ IRC Section 104(a)(2)
  16. To preserve the tax-free status of structured settlement payments under IRC Section 104(a)(2), the annuity used to fund payments must be purchased by: โ†’ The defendant, insurer, or a qualified assignment company โ€” not the claimant
  17. What is 'double-dipping' in the context of structured settlement factoring? โ†’ A claimant selling the same payments to two different factoring companies
  18. A claimant sells future structured settlement payments to a factoring company for immediate cash. The IRS generally treats the proceeds from this sale as: โ†’ Ordinary income taxable in the year received
  19. What is the role of a structured settlement consultant or broker? โ†’ To design and negotiate the structured settlement payment plan on behalf of the plaintiff
  20. Which of the following would cause a structured settlement to lose its income-tax-free status? โ†’ Allowing the claimant to accelerate, commute, or assign payments at will
  21. Workers' compensation structured settlements derive their tax-free status from which IRC section? โ†’ IRC Section 104(a)(1)
  22. What is the primary advantage of a structured settlement over a lump-sum payment for a physical injury claimant in the US? โ†’ All periodic payments are income-tax-free under IRC ยง104
  23. A structured settlement for emotional distress claims with no underlying physical injury would result in: โ†’ Fully taxable periodic payments as ordinary income
  24. What does 'inflation risk' mean in the context of a level-payment structured settlement? โ†’ The risk that fixed payments will lose purchasing power over time as prices rise
  25. What does 'present value' mean in the context of structured settlements? โ†’ The current worth of future payments discounted at an assumed interest rate
  26. Why might a claimant prefer increasing payments over level payments in a structured settlement? โ†’ Increasing payments help offset inflation and rising medical costs over time
  27. The total stream of structured settlement periodic payments, including the portion attributable to earnings growth within the annuity, is: โ†’ Entirely excluded from the claimant's gross income under IRC Section 104(a)(2)
  28. What is the typical timeline from application to court approval of a structured settlement transfer? โ†’ 45โ€“90 days, depending on state procedural requirements and court calendars
  29. Which of the following cases does NOT qualify for income-tax-free treatment under IRC ยง104(a)(2)? โ†’ Employment discrimination (non-physical) settlement
  30. What does 'annuity certain' mean in structured settlement planning? โ†’ An annuity that pays for a fixed period regardless of the annuitant's survival
